VYM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

1,601 of the 6,942 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anguard High Dividend Yield ETF (VYM)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$20.3B — up 1.3% from $20.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 129 funds opened new VYM positions and 76 closed out — a net gain of 53 holders — while 566 added to existing stakes and 643 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Cetera Investment Advisers, adding an estimated $155M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$1B.
